How Much Does a Nicaragua Travel Budget Cost in 2026

How Much Does a Nicaragua Travel Budget

You start to relax when you see realistic numbers. Nicaragua is still one of the cheapest countries in Central America. A budget traveler can spend around 25 to 40 dollars per day. A mid range traveler may spend 50 to 90 dollars depending on comfort level.

You notice how inflation has changed small things. Food and accommodation prices have increased slightly after 2024. However, compared to nearby countries, nicaragua travel budget remains affordable and friendly for long stays.

Accommodation Cost in Nicaragua for Budget and Mid Range Travelers

Accommodation Cost in Nicaragua

You feel surprised when you check hotel prices. Hostels remain the cheapest option. Dorm beds usually cost 8 to 15 dollars per night. Private rooms in budget hotels range between 20 to 50 dollars depending on location.

You understand the value when you compare options. Airbnb stays are becoming popular in cities like Granada and León. These give better comfort at reasonable prices, which helps manage your overall nicaragua travel budget.

Real Example of Daily Accommodation Cost

You get clarity from real numbers. A traveler spent around 601 dollars on accommodation during the trip. This equals about 46 dollars per day. When shared, it becomes even cheaper at around 23 dollars per person.

Food Cost in Nicaragua and Daily Eating Budget

Food Cost in Nicaragua and Daily

You feel relief when you see how affordable food can be. Local meals cost between 3 to 6 dollars. Street food is even cheaper and still delicious. Traditional dishes give you both taste and value.

You spend more only when you choose tourist restaurants. Western style meals can cost 10 to 15 dollars. Staying local helps you control your nicaragua travel budget without missing out on good food.

Transportation Cost in Nicaragua for Travelers

Transportation Cost in Nicaragua

You notice how easy it is to move around. Local buses are extremely cheap. Most rides cost less than one dollar. Chicken buses remain the most affordable way to travel between cities.

You save more when you avoid private taxis. Shared shuttles are also available for longer routes. A real example shows total transport cost was only 20 dollars, which is around 1.50 dollars per day.

Activities and Entrance Fees in Nicaragua

You feel excited when you explore activities. Nicaragua offers volcano boarding, island tours, and beach experiences at low cost. Many attractions cost between 5 to 15 dollars.

You plan better when you know the average. A traveler spent around 143 dollars on activities. That equals about 11 dollars per day. This makes nicaragua travel budget very attractive for adventure lovers.

Total Nicaragua Travel Budget Breakdown with Real Numbers

You understand everything clearly when numbers come together. This table shows a real cost breakdown from a traveler experience.

CategoryTotal CostDaily Average
Accommodation$601$46
Transport$20$1.50
Activities$143$11
Food$253$19.50

You notice how balanced the spending is. This helps you plan your own budget with confidence and accuracy.

Is Nicaragua Cheaper Than Costa Rica in 2026

You compare options before making a decision. Costa Rica is known to be more expensive. Accommodation and food prices are almost double in many areas.

You see why travelers choose Nicaragua. It offers similar beaches and nature at a lower cost. This makes nicaragua travel budget more attractive for budget travelers.

Nicaragua Backpacker Budget 2026

You feel motivated when you see low budget options. Backpackers can easily travel under 30 dollars per day. This includes hostel stays, local food, and cheap transport.

You control your spending with simple choices. Avoid luxury options and stick to local experiences. This keeps your nicaragua travel budget low without reducing enjoyment.

Monthly Cost of Living in Nicaragua

You think long term when planning extended travel. A monthly budget can range from 700 to 1200 dollars depending on lifestyle.

You save more when you stay longer. Renting apartments and cooking meals reduces daily expenses. This makes Nicaragua a good option for digital nomads.

FAQs

What is a realistic daily budget for traveling in Nicaragua?

You feel more relaxed when numbers are clear. A realistic daily budget in Nicaragua ranges from 25 to 40 dollars for budget travelers. Mid range travelers may spend 50 to 90 dollars depending on comfort, food choices, and travel style.

Is Nicaragua still cheap to travel in 2026?

You notice the difference when you compare countries. Nicaragua is still cheaper than most Central American destinations. Even after price changes, it offers affordable food, transport, and accommodation for travelers on a tight budget.

How much money do you need for a week in Nicaragua?

You plan better when you see total cost early. A one week trip in Nicaragua can cost between 200 to 400 dollars for budget travelers. This includes stay, food, transport, and basic activities.

Can you travel Nicaragua on a backpacker budget?


You feel confident when you keep things simple. Yes, you can travel Nicaragua on a backpacker budget under 30 dollars per day. Staying in hostels and eating local food helps you manage your spending easily.
